OBD I
codes 332, 337 ( I think )
1 of them is EGR flow insuffecent. the other is EGR/PFE circuit voltage out of range.
well the EGR system is known as a Pressure feedback system the way it works is the PFE or (pressure feedback) sensor monitors the exhaust gas pressure via rubber hose connected from sensor to manifold. difference's in pressure relate to the actual EGR valves position. the EGR vacuum solanoid controls the egr valve's actions.
Well the check engine light has apparently been coming on, flashing, and sometimes go's out. (thats what my grandmother told me it was doing.) It was solid on when I was handed the keys this morning. So I scanned it KOEO test pulled no immideate codes. only those 2 memory codes mentioned before. codes have been cleared and definitions wrote down.
Checked the EGR valve using a vac pump and it did show movement both engine idle and smoothness, so i would assume that the passage is open and the valve does move when VAC is applied.
I think is a faulty PFE sensor.
the engine had a very slight miss/unsmoothness at idle. I also noticed a slight pinging under heavy accelleration. its about to roll 100k plug and wire set has already been planned along with fuel filter.
